  • Easy way to get SBs?
  • MAM8A 245300_XBLM MAM8A 245300_XBL

    More important than taking an extra step lead to me has been waiting for a 2 ball count.
    You can also steal 3rd with two outs pretty easily against the CPU with 70+ speed. In this case you can take a free extra step and go on any pitch. Even better if you have 1st and 2nd 2 outs with decent speed on 2nd. You get 2 steals and they always go for the lead runner

  • Two questions about Battle Royale
  • MAM8A 245300_XBLM MAM8A 245300_XBL

    The game slows down on the pitching side to allow the consoles to sync back up smoothly for when the ball is put in play. Your opponent is not getting that slow of a pitch to hit, it looks normal on their end

    No, you missed mine. You have a better chance at winning any given game by squaring the ball up more than your opponent. That does not mean you will win. Yes in the long run your results will likely regress to your expected win percentage, but that's because you will win the individual games you make better contact than your opponent a large majority of the time, but not always. There will be (fewer) times when you lose with a 75% expected win, but you'd expect that 1 out of every 4 times.
